This is a story of love at first sight. That of Markus Friesacher for Namibia, its deserts, its inhabitants, flora and fauna. The owner of the Austrian company Gmundner Keramik, the oldest European ceramics company, opened this lodge in 2022 as an autonomous and sustainable local project. Less than an hour from the capital, Windhoek, Gmundner Lodge combines exquisite refinement with unforgettable immersions in wild, unspoiled nature. With a nod to the luxurious safari camps of adventurers from another era, its suites are housed within large tents. Inside, expect teak flooring, Persian rugs, Chesterfield armchairs, four-poster beds wrapped in mosquito nets, and chests of drawers that resemble travel trunks... Bathtubs are found outside, on the terrace, promising sublime relaxation under the gaze of the animals that pass through these 14,800-acres of Kalahari savannah. The lodge, which has a large swimming pool and spa, runs on solar energy and its farm produces vegetables and fruits served in the restaurant. The lodge seamlessly combines social commitments with the preservation of regional culture and traditions through an art project to support the indigenous San people. Gmundner Lodge is also proudly run by locals, whose inherent and diverse knowledge of Namibia makes for a more meaningful cultural exchange with visitors.

Painting on ceramic

In Austria, the name Gmundner is synonymous with sublime craftsmanship: it is the oldest ceramic factory in Europe, founded in 1492. Proud of its origins and its relationship to the land and traditional artisanship, Gmundner Lodge offers guests the opportunity to paint their own creations. In a dedicated workshop, and guided by a seasoned potter, you can give free rein to your imagination.

Guided safaris

Tailor-made safaris are offered at sunrise and at nightfall, when the sky paints the landscape breathtaking colors. Experienced guides, passionate and well-informed about this unique environment, will help you discover the fauna, flora and legends of the Kalahari-arguably the most extensive and fascinating desert in the world-making for a truly unforgettable adventure.

Riding in the savannah

Explore the vast Gmundner estate and its 6,000 hectares of wild nature on horseback along unforgettable trails. Let the beauty of the landscape wash over you, while an experienced guide shares the secrets of the savannah-you will undoubtedly come across herds of grazing springbok, or zebras peacefully exploring the territory. The experience is even more magical at first light, when the sun sets the horizon ablaze.
